AG, SAG & Ball Mill - Increase Grinding Efficiency
To ALL:
We have developed a new patented liner geometry for all types of mills. The new liner concept increases grinding efficiency (reduced power, increased throughput and improved grind size). A measure of the success shows a significant benefit over our gains with the 40 ft SAG mill at Cadia Mine in Australia.
Cadia's success was published at the SAG2006 conference. It showed a 6% gain in throughput and 47% increase in production tonnage/kg of liner use.
The new liner geometry, in theory, shows much greater gains when measuring comminution by increased ore surface area.
Conveyor Dynamics, Inc. (CDI) have not been able to offer this new method due to our 5 year agreement with Metso Minerals. That agreement has lapsed. We are now back in business. ■
